1. INSTALLATION DATA SHEET
A.
Your “INSTALLATION DATA SHEET” looks like
Fig. 3–A
. It is found
inside
the door hardware box. You will need to refer to the data on this sheet during
installation. Record the pertinent data on page 7 of this manual as a backup.
B.
Verify that the “Factory Order Number” on the door components matches the one shown on the INSTALLATION DATA SHEET.
2. PRE-INSTALLATION CHECK LIST
Ensure the door installation can be accomplished before proceeding.
• Check that the wall opening,
Fig. 3–B
, matches the Opening Width and Height shown on the Installation Data Sheet.
• Check that the sill is level and plumb.
• Verify the guides you received are suitable for the jambs. Compare the guide type on the Installation Data Sheet with
Fig. 3–C
.
